The Hardin County Education Association invites all area children and their families to their Read Across America: Celebrating Diverse Readers event, to be held Saturday from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. at Central Hardin High School.
“It is going to just show kids how much fun reading can be,” said Education Association President and North Hardin High School Special Education Teacher Staci Riggs. “It’s going to have activities, coloring things, we will have character appearances happening, there will be food trucks out front.”
The event is free and open to the public, and will also feature special appearances by community members.
“Someone from the sheriff’s office, we have several principals, assistant principals, and support staff of Hardin County Schools, they’re going to be reading books to the students and any kids that want to come,” Riggs said. “Students do not have to be at school age, so any kids are welcome to attend.”
No registration is required to attend.
